Block walls serve both practical and visual purposes in landscaping, offering structure, privacy, and visual interest to outside spaces. These walls can be utilized to retain soil on sloped properties, specify garden beds, or develop clear limits within a landscape. The choice of block type-- concrete, interlocking, or ornamental-- affects both the strength and appearance of the wall. Proper planning ensures stability, specifically for taller walls, with factors to consider for drain, support, and soil pressure. Installation begins with a well-prepared base, typically involving excavation and leveling to make sure the wall remains straight and steady over time. Mortar or adhesive may be utilized depending on the block type, and support like rebar can improve toughness. A knowledgeable landscaper guarantees each course is level and aligned, preventing future shifting or breaking. Block walls likewise use imaginative chances through finishes, textures, and colors, allowing them to match the surrounding landscape. Incorporating lighting, planters, or cascading plants can soften the difficult edges, making the wall both useful and visually appealing. Routine examinations and minor repair work assist maintain the wall's integrity for several years to come
